Inspectorate of Public Health Urges Public Not to Eat Fish from the Fresh/Great Salt Ponds | Soualiganewsday
Loading...

SINT MAARTEN (GREAT BAY) – Due to yet unknown reasons a large quantity of fish has been found dead in the water flow channel between Fresh Pond and Great Salt Pond, near the Illidge Road roundabout, the Inspectorate of Public Health, Social Development and Labor (Inspectorate VSA) said in a statement on Saturday.

“The heat and direct sunlight are speeding up the rotting process and is producing a very unpleasant stench.

“The Government is doing its utmost to remove the dead fish as fast as possible and dispose of them in an appropriate manner. We ask the public for their understanding with this situation and continuing cooperation in this matter.

“That being said, we hereby issue an alert to the public that any fish recovered from this site, dead or alive, may constitute a serious risk for the health of humans and animals.

“The Inspectorate of VSA and its division of Food Safety, strongly advice everyone to abstain from consuming fish from this site.

“We recommend everyone to buy fish only at the established points of sale, where the regular and accepted controls have taken place by the Inspectorate, and the safety of the fish is guaranteed,” Inspectorate VSA concludes in its statement.
